Location guide
Hobson County Park, located in the United States, has a reputation for modest yet consistent surfing conditions. It boasts a beautiful beach with stretchy white sands, embraced by the sparkling blue ocean. Surfing conditions at Hobson County Park cater to intermediate and experienced surfers the most. The region hosts a predominantly rocky bottom, making it essential for surfers to have a clear understanding of the ocean floor. The waves can build up substantially, offering long, medium-paced rides that can truly test the rider’s endurance and wave-reading ability. It's worth noting that this beach doesn't witness the biggest swells. The waves are typically short to medium in length. They generally come in sets of five or seven with average wave heights ranging between 3 to 5 feet on most days. However, on days with a strong offshore wind, surfers may get lucky and find higher waves. Winds do play an important role in the surf conditions here. Predominant winds blow from the North which creates an offshore effect, perfect for clean, well-rounded waves. On a good day, when there is a solid South-West swell combined with a North wind, you can expect to score some powerful and high-quality, shoulder-to-head high waves.
